The structure of the program would feature a media curtain raiser that
would precede the ambient inaugural session with the
keynote address to be delivered by a former distinguished diplomat. The
inaugural session would be followed by two technical sessions that would
explore the vicissitudes of contemporary International Studies featuring expert
presentations by academic, policy research and media specialists drawn from all
over the country.
The primary objectives of this seminar would be the sensitizing of the
present and prospective student community of the salience of International
Studies as academic choice that offers value addition in teaching, research,
media and corporate careers an avenue of challenge and motivation for
excellence in an age of pervasive globalization.
